Insect antibiotic provides new way to eliminate bacteria

Friday, November 16, 2018 - 15:50 in Biology & Nature

An antibiotic called thanatin attacks the way the outer membrane of Gram-negative bacteria is built. Researchers have now found out that this happens through a previously unknown mechanism. Thanatin, produced naturally by the spined soldier bug, can therefore be used to develop new classes of antibiotics.
